What Features Make a Lithium Chainsaw Ideal for Small Projects?

Battery life plays a crucial role in the usability of lithium chainsaws; they typically offer sufficient power to tackle small jobs without the hassle of needing to recharge constantly. When choosing a chainsaw, it’s important to consider models with longer battery life to ensure efficiency.

Low maintenance is another advantage of lithium chainsaws. Unlike gas models that require regular oil changes and fuel mixing, lithium chainsaws simply need the battery charged and occasional cleaning, which saves time and effort.

User-friendly controls enhance accessibility for novice users, as many models incorporate features like automatic chain tensioning and tool-free chain adjustments, making them easier to operate safely. This reduces the learning curve for those new to chainsaws.

Quiet operation is particularly advantageous in residential settings, where noise can be a concern. Lithium chainsaws produce significantly less sound than gas-powered equivalents, allowing users to work without disturbing neighbors.

Environmental considerations are increasingly important, and lithium chainsaws address this by producing no emissions during use. This makes them a responsible choice for those who are conscious of their environmental impact while completing small tasks around the yard.

What Advantages Do Lithium Chainsaws Offer Over Traditional Chainsaws?

Lithium chainsaws offer several advantages over traditional gas-powered chainsaws, making them a popular choice for users seeking efficiency and convenience.

  • Lightweight Design: Lithium chainsaws are generally lighter than their gas counterparts, which makes them easier to handle and maneuver for extended periods. This lightweight design is especially beneficial for users who may struggle with heavier tools, reducing fatigue and improving overall productivity.
  • Quiet Operation: These chainsaws operate much quieter than traditional models, which is advantageous in residential areas or noise-sensitive environments. The reduced noise levels allow for more comfortable use without disturbing neighbors or wildlife.
  • Low Maintenance: Lithium chainsaws require significantly less maintenance than gas chainsaws, as they do not need oil changes, spark plug replacements, or fuel mixing. This simplicity not only saves time and effort but also lowers the overall cost of ownership.
  • Instant Start: With a lithium chainsaw, users can enjoy the convenience of instant startup with just the push of a button, eliminating the need for pull cords and reducing frustration during use. This feature is especially useful for quick tasks or when working in remote locations.
  • Environmental Benefits: Lithium chainsaws produce no emissions during operation, making them a more environmentally friendly option compared to gas models. This characteristic appeals to eco-conscious consumers and contributes to cleaner air quality.
  • Battery Technology: Advances in battery technology mean that lithium chainsaws can provide longer runtimes and faster charging times. Users can often complete more tasks on a single charge, increasing efficiency and reducing downtime.

How Do Battery Life and Performance Impact Your Choice of Lithium Chainsaw?

Performance: The performance of a lithium chainsaw is determined by its cutting speed and ability to handle different types of wood. A powerful motor paired with a high-capacity battery can provide quick cuts and better handling of tough materials, making it more effective for various tasks.

Charging Time: Fast charging capabilities can minimize downtime, allowing users to return to work quickly. Chainsaws that require lengthy charging periods can hinder workflow, especially if multiple batteries are not available.

Battery Capacity: A higher amp-hour rating means that the battery can sustain power for a longer time, which is beneficial for heavy-duty work. Understanding the capacity helps users estimate how long they can work before needing a recharge, making it easier to plan their tasks.

Weight and Balance: A well-balanced chainsaw reduces fatigue during prolonged use, making it more comfortable to handle. If the battery adds significant weight to the chainsaw, it can lead to strain and decrease maneuverability, which is particularly relevant for small, lightweight models.

What Should You Consider When Choosing a Budget-Friendly Lithium Chainsaw?

When choosing a budget-friendly lithium chainsaw, several key factors should be taken into account to ensure you make the best choice for your needs.

  • Battery Life: Consider the capacity of the battery, which is often measured in amp-hours (Ah). A higher Ah rating typically indicates longer operational time before needing a recharge, allowing you to complete more tasks without interruption.
  • Weight: The overall weight of the chainsaw is crucial, especially for prolonged use. A lighter model can reduce fatigue and make it easier to maneuver, which is particularly important for smaller users or when working in tight spaces.
  • Bar Length: The length of the chainsaw bar affects the size of the wood it can cut. Shorter bars are better for small tasks like pruning, while longer bars can handle larger logs; ensure you choose a size that matches your intended use.
  • Chain Speed: The chain speed, measured in feet per second (fps), influences how quickly and efficiently the chainsaw can cut through wood. A higher chain speed can lead to cleaner cuts and quicker work, making it an important specification for performance.
  • Build Quality: Look for a chainsaw that is made from durable materials to withstand regular use. A well-constructed chainsaw will not only last longer but also provide better safety and reliability during operation.
  • Safety Features: Safety features such as chain brakes, hand guards, and automatic oiling systems are essential for preventing accidents and ensuring smooth operation. These features can significantly enhance user safety, especially for those new to using chainsaws.
  • Customer Reviews: Always check customer feedback and ratings to gauge the performance and reliability of the chainsaw. Real-world experiences can provide insights into how well the chainsaw performs over time and its overall value for money.
